C++ Variable



  • Hallo Leute,

    ich wollt fragen wie man mit Visual C++ Variablen ein Wert gibt.
    Habs versucht aber es klappt nicht

    public: System::Void button1_Click_3(System::Object^  sender, System::EventArgs^  e) {
    				int x;
    				x = textBox1->Text;
    				textBox1->Text = x.ToString();
    		 }
    


  • naja, du versuchst einen int wert auf einen string zu legen....

    Konvertieren und dann müssts gehen.

    public: System::Void button1_Click_3(System::Object^  sender, System::EventArgs^  e) {
                    int x;
                    x = Convert::ToInt32(textBox1->Text);
                    textBox1->Text = x.ToString();
             }
    


  • Wenn ich das mache kommt zwar keine Fehlermeldung doch wenn ich auf Button 1 klicke kommt ein Fenster in dem das hier steht:

    Eine nicht behandelte Ausnahme des Typs "System.FormatException" ist in mscorlib.dll aufgetreten.

    Zusätzliche Informationen: Die Eingabezeichenfolge hat das falsche Format.

    und dann geht das Programm auch zu.



  • ohh ok hat sich schon erledigt 😃

    Danke 🙂


Anmelden zum Antworten